Transaction 43c72af2591c2a8925abdd6b3cbb2d301d0496e866e7fc39e68fa8890690c1c4

1 Input
2 Outputs
  • 43c72af2591c2a8925abdd6b3cbb2d301d0496e866e7fc39e68fa8890690c1c4:0
  • value  1070000
    address  3AeJpAfByqPw5jGpX2m2Gfk8SGgMg3g3yF
  • 43c72af2591c2a8925abdd6b3cbb2d301d0496e866e7fc39e68fa8890690c1c4:1
  • value  2420252
    address  32zxV6AbffisP2B3DwSMmoq26KmM4A6WgZ